Aiton's Encyclopedia (1910)

Luther, an American horticulturist. He was born at Lancaster, Massachusetts, March 7, 1849. He was reared on a farm. He labored four years to develop a smooth, mealy, good-sized potato, one reasonably free from insect plagues. The Burbank potato was the result. With means obtained from selling seed potatoes, in 1875 he opened an experimental farm at Santa Rosa, California. He is the most distinguished American improver of fruits and vegetables. He has originated the Burbank potato, half a dozen valuable plums, three prunes, two choice callas, several roses, and a number of new varieties of apples, peaches, nuts, flowers, and vegetables. His grounds are a center of interest. Seemingly nothing is beyond his skill. He has even developed a white blackberry, to which he has given the name of the iceberg. Wonders are expected of a spineless cactus which, it is hoped, may prove a suitable plant for cattle on the arid plain. Burbank's general plan of work is to hasten the process of evolution by supplying conditions as to fertility, heat, and moisture that will bring on changes more rapidly than nature would do. Of ten thousand plants, he selects a few and destroys the rest. Of many thousand descendants of these plants, he destroys all but a few and so on. Starting with a red poppy that shows a spot of yellow, he raised a plot of poppies. A few showed yellow. These he cared for and destroyed the others. Seeds from these produced a plot of poppies showing more yellow. He saved the best and destroyed the rest, until he had a variety of yellow poppies with blossoms six inches in diameter coming true from the seed. He is called the wizard of horticulture, but he resents the name, as he relies on skill, judgment, and patience, not on magic. He adopts and hastens nature's ways. See Mutation Mr. Burbank has made no effort to make money out of his new varieties. He is too busy for that. He says his time is worth $250 an hour to the world. In a money sense, he has remained a poor man. The Carnegie Institute, however, has placed $100,000, or $10,000 a year for ten years, at his disposal, so that he is now in the very joy of carrying on his work with no lack of means. He says of his own work: One more grain to the head of wheat, rye, barley, oats or rice; one more kernel of corn to the ear; one more potato to the hill or peach, pear, plum, orange, or nut to the tree would add millions of bushels to the world's food supply, millions of dollars to the world's wealth, not for one year only but as a permanent legacy. That is what I am trying to do. I have here a plant school to suppress the bad and develop the good qualities of flowers, fruits, and all useful plants. I give them everything they need as a wise mother does to children--the right conditions of soil and climate and food--fertilizer. I keep the evil away, sterilizing the soil and water as you sterilize milk for infants. It takes ten generations, sometimes, for a plant to overcome a hereditary fault but the work is always rewarded in the end, and the world is the richer. Collier's New Encyclopedia (1921)

LUTHER, an American naturalist; born at Lancaster, Mass., March 7, 1849. Much of his boyhood was spent on a farm, a circumstance to which is attributable the love of nature that led him, after three years in a wood-turning plant in Worcester, Mass., to direct his attention to horticulture, especially with the view of experimenting with new specimens. He bought a farm at Lunenburg, Mass., and devoted himself to the study of new varieties of fruits, vegetables, and flowers. He removed to Santa Rosa, Cal., in 1875, and established his experimental farm under conditions of soil and climate most favorable for his investigations. Here his successes were so pronounced that he was considered a veritable wizard of horticulture. He was the originator of new species of chestnuts and walnuts; of the low bushlike Delaware plumtree; of the Burbank plum, introduced with great success in New Zealand and south Africa; as well as of the Nickson, Gold, Chalco, and other new species of plum. From crossing with different varieties he has produced many hybrids, among the most remarkable of which is a white blackberry. Not the least wonderful of his results have been obtained with flowers; the Shasta daisy, and the gigantic amaryllis, being among his many remarkable discoveries. His gardens constitute one of the features of that section of California, not only on account of the results of his skill, but also on account of their extensive operations, 80,000 lilies at one time being seen in full bloom. The Carnegie Institution awarded him $10,000 for 10 years for his experiments.
